postgresql

【PostgreSQL教程】PostgreSQL 高级篇之 视图

PostgreSQL 高级篇之视图在数据库管理系统中,视图是一种虚拟表,它并不存储实际的数据,而是根据查询所定义的一组表和列生成的一个结果集。这使得视图可以用于简化复杂的查询、增强数据安全性以及提高数据的可重用性。本文将围绕 PostgreSQL 中的视图进行深入探讨,包括视图的创建、用途、维护以

一文带你了解三大开源关系型数据库:SQLite、MySQL和PostgreSQL

在当今的软件开发和数据处理领域,关系型数据库发挥着不可或缺的作用。开源关系型数据库以其灵活性、可扩展性和社区支持在开发者中备受青睐。本文将为您详细介绍三款开源关系型数据库:SQLite、MySQL和PostgreSQL,帮助您了解它们的特点及使用场景。SQLiteSQLite 是一个轻量级的关系

Linux安装部署PostgreSQL详细步骤

在Linux环境下安装和部署PostgreSQL是一项常见的任务,尤其是在开发和生产环境中。下面将详细介绍在Ubuntu和CentOS这两种常见的Linux发行版上安装PostgreSQL的步骤。在Ubuntu上安装PostgreSQL更新系统包: 在安装任何新软件之前,建议先更新系统的

PostgreSQL企业升级实战,细节满满

PostgreSQL企业升级实战,细节满满在企业级应用中,PostgreSQL作为一种广泛使用的关系数据库,其稳定性、性能和功能性都受到众多企业的青睐。当数据库版本更新时,如何安全地进行企业级升级显得尤为重要。本文将结合具体步骤与代码示例,深入探讨PostgreSQL的企业升级实战。一、升级准备

一文搞定postgreSQL

一文搞定 PostgreSQLPostgreSQL 是一个功能强大的开源关系型数据库管理系统,以其稳定性、可扩展性和丰富的功能受到广泛喜爱。本文将通过几个关键概念和代码示例,快速带你入门 PostgreSQL 的使用。1. 安装 PostgreSQL在 Ubuntu 系统中,你可以通过以下命令

【postgresql初级使用】视图上的触发器instead of,替代计划的rewrite,实现不一样的审计日志

PostgreSQL视图上的触发器:使用INSTEAD OF触发器进行审计日志在PostgreSQL中,视图是一种虚拟表,它通过查询生成,可以简化复杂查询的使用。然而,视图本身并不存储数据,而是从基础表中生成数据。这就带来一个问题,当我们尝试对视图进行插入、更新或删除操作时,PostgreSQL会

PostgreSQL分区表,实战细节满满

在大数据时代,数据库的性能优化显得尤为重要。PostgreSQL 作为一个强大的开源关系型数据库,提供了分区表的功能,可以有效地处理海量数据,提高查询性能和维护方便性。本文将介绍 PostgreSQL 分区表的基本概念、创建步骤和实战细节。一、什么是分区表?分区表是一种把大表分割成多个小表(称为

PostgreSQL 17即将发布,新功能Top 3

PostgreSQL 17的推出引发了广泛关注,作为一个开源的对象关系数据库系统,它持续不断地增强自身的功能,以适应不断变化的需求。随着新版本的即将发布,PostgreSQL 17引入了一些颇具创新性的功能。本文将介绍其中的三个重要新特性,并附上代码示例,以增强理解。1. 可并行化的聚合函数在数

PostgreSQL 中进行数据导入和导出

在 PostgreSQL 中,数据导入和导出是日常数据库操作中非常重要的一部分,尤其是在数据迁移、备份以及与其他系统集成的场景中。PostgreSQL 提供了一些强大的工具和命令,可以帮助我们方便地进行数据的导入和导出。一、数据导出PostgreSQL 提供 COPY 命令和 pg_dump 工

PostgreSQL 教程:从入门到精通

PostgreSQL 教程:从入门到精通PostgreSQL 是一个功能强大的开源关系数据库管理系统,它以其标准的 SQL 支持和大量的扩展功能而闻名。在这篇文章中,我们将从基础入手,逐步深入 PostgreSQL 的一些高级特性,带你踏上一段数据库之旅。1. 安装 PostgreSQL首先,